A task force in Hyderabad conducted inspections across bakeries on January 3, 2025, uncovering severe hygiene and regulatory violations. Serious infractions included the presence of rat faeces, expired ingredients, structural issues, undisclosed rum usage, inadequate labeling, and lacking essential documents, all risking public health.

A mysterious illness in Jammu and Kashmir's Badhaal village has caused 17 deaths since December 2024, with 38 people affected. An inter-ministerial team is investigating the cause, suspected to be neurotoxins causing brain swelling. Tests ruled out communicable diseases but found toxins in samples analyzed by top laboratories. The exact source remains unidentified.

Nearly 2,000 years ago, a young man's brain in Herculaneum turned to glass during Mount Vesuvius' eruption, due to extreme heat and rapid cooling. Scientists discovered this unique transformation in 2018, offering insights into volcanic ash clouds and potential protective measures for modern volcanic threats.
